CFP: 2nd IMA Conference on Flood Risk Assessment

by Hamish Harvey last modified 2006-12-04 08:55

The conference will provide a forum at which engineers, mathematicians and statisticians can meet to exchange views on this important technical area. The emphasis will be on new developments in the mathematical and statistical techniques applicable for assessing flood risk. The conference will be of interest to flood defence practitioners; flood defence managers; statisticians, mathematicians and civil engineers in research and universities.

We look forward to contributions drawing upon diverse conceptual bases, including reliability theory, statistical analysis, mathematical modelling of flood flows, forecasting systems and techniques, and of course mathematics. Papers will be organised under six principal themes:

  • Reliability analysis of flood defence systems

  • Rainfall prediction

  • Statistical Modelling of extremes

  • Modelling flow in fluvial and coastal environments

  • Flood forecasting

  • Uncertainty propagation and ensemble prediction systems

Abstract submission deadline: 31 January 2007.
